Arabian Hills Estate is a freehold land project by Deca Properties at Al Faqa, in Abu Dhabi’s eastern desert along the Dubai–Al Ain Road. What is sold here is the plot, not the house. That is a rare product in this market: almost all off-plan supply in the UAE arrives as a finished unit, and freehold land a foreign buyer can develop themselves exists in only a handful of places. The masterplan covers around 244 million sq ft across fourteen phases, which puts it closer in scale to a small town than to a gated compound.

For context, a villa plot in an established Dubai community rarely passes 6,000 sq ft, so even the entry tier here is several times the usual footprint. Space is what the desert location buys. The same money spent closer to either city would not cover a fraction of this area.
The community is planned around swimmable lagoons and a beach, with pools, an aqua park, a Zen garden, nature trails, playing fields and picnic grounds running through the landscaped zones. The anchor is a polo and equestrian club, and that is a deliberate fit rather than a luxury flourish: horses need land and quiet, and Al Faqa has both in a way no coastal site in the UAE can offer. Delivery is staged across phases rather than all at once, under a development budget of around AED 22 billion.
Two things separate this from an ordinary off-plan purchase. The first is cost. The plot price is not the house price, and construction sits with the buyer as a separate budget on a separate timeline, which is why plot buyers need a longer horizon and more liquidity than apartment buyers. The second is control. Very little else at this level lets a buyer set their own footprint, orientation and architecture instead of picking from a developer’s three floor plans. Payment is structured with a booking deposit, instalments through development and a substantial share falling due after handover, which eases the cash requirement while a house is being built.
